¡Activa las notificaciones laborales por email!

Software Engineer

buscojobs España

Palencia

Presencial

EUR 40.000 - 80.000

Jornada completa

Hace 30+ días

Mejora tus posibilidades de llegar a la entrevista

Elabora un currículum adaptado a la vacante para tener más posibilidades de triunfar.

Descripción de la vacante

An innovative company is seeking a talented Software Engineer skilled in Java or Kotlin to join a dynamic development team. This role focuses on designing and optimizing applications for large-scale operations, ensuring high performance and reliability. You will be responsible for developing secure applications that handle millions of requests daily while collaborating with architects and cross-functional teams. If you are passionate about software development and eager to contribute to a high-performing team, this opportunity is perfect for you.

Formación

  • Strong experience with Java and Kotlin required.
  • Solid knowledge of Spring and Agile methodologies essential.

Responsabilidades

  • Develop high-quality software using TDD, DDD, and Clean Code principles.
  • Collaborate with architects to define technical solutions.

Conocimientos

Java
Kotlin
Analytical mindset
Problem-solving
Fluency in English

Educación

Minimum 4 years of experience as a software engineer

Herramientas

Spring
Spring Boot
AWS
Kubernetes
RabbitMQ
Kafka

Descripción del empleo

We are looking for a Software Engineer with strong expertise in Java or Kotlin to join a high-performing development team. The role involves designing, developing, and optimizing applications that handle large-scale operations, collaborating with architects and cross-functional teams.

Key Responsibilities:

  • Develop high-quality software using TDD, DDD, Clean Code, and SOLID principles.
  • Build secure, scalable applications handling millions of requests daily.
  • Work with architects and engineers to define technical solutions, ensuring reliability and performance.
  • Identify and solve complex challenges, aligning technical solutions with business needs.
  • Contribute to the team’s growth by sharing knowledge and mentoring.

Required Qualifications:

  • Strong experience with Java and Kotlin.
  • Minimum of 4 years of experience as a software engineer.
  • Solid knowledge of Spring / Spring Boot.
  • Experience with Clean Code, SOLID principles, and Agile methodologies.
  • Analytical mindset with a data-driven approach to problem-solving.
  • Fluency in English, written and spoken.

Preferred Qualifications:

  • Experience in a product-based company.
  • Experience with pair programming.
  • Familiarity with AWS, Microservices, Kubernetes, and messaging queues (RabbitMQ, Kafka).
  • Knowledge of Extreme Programming (XP) practices.
Consigue la evaluación confidencial y gratuita de tu currículum.
o arrastra un archivo en formato PDF, DOC, DOCX, ODT o PAGES de hasta 5 MB.